Business Segments and Global Operations
Operating across two primary segments, Otis Worldwide focuses on New Equipment and Service. The New Equipment division manages the design, manufacturing, and installation of elevators and escalators for residential, commercial, and infrastructure developments. The Service segment offers maintenance, repair, and modernization services that contribute to the longevity and safety of transportation systems.
Through operations in key markets such as the United States and China, along with other international regions, Otis Worldwide continues to expand its influence across major metropolitan areas and growing urban centers.
